what is that thing on the engine that revs it ?
I have a very noob question for you guys, what is that latch mechanism thing that revs the engine in neutral. It is located on top the engine area itself, you pull it and it revs the engine... My car is an e30 and this is not something i have seen before please advise..

Yep, that's the throttle linkage. I'm inclined to think every car you've had has one, but maybe very new stuff has everything hidden out of sight. Pulling that all the way is the same as flooring the throttle pedal, so keep that in mind.

While you’ve discovered the throttle it doesn’t hurt to squirt some wd-40 into the cable, if you have cruise control you’ll see two cables.
If you read the label on WD40 it is actually not a lubricant. Best cable lube IMO is a couple of drops of machine oil and let gravity do its magic
